Regular face cleansing lays the groundwork of maintaining clear skin. Over time, the skin accumulates impurities, oil, and bacteria, if left unchecked, can lead to blemishes, lack of radiance, and other concerns. Proper washing gets rid of these impurities, guaranteeing a fresh facial area. That being said, it’s important to apply a non-irritating cleanser tailored to one’s skin type to avoid irritation. Harsh products might remove natural oils, resulting in inflammation. Sensitive skin types must choose fragrance-free formulas. Those with excess sebum benefit from foaming cleansers that regulate oil without overcompensating. Hydrating cream-based products work best for parched complexions, providing moisture retention.
Post-cleansing, using a moisturizer is the next crucial step for protecting the skin. Hydrating lotions help to restore moisture, reducing the chances of dehydration or redness. Every skin type, keeping moisture intact is key. Those with excess oil production can opt for gel-based moisturizers that maintain elasticity without greasiness. For dry skin, an intense moisture-locking option is more effective. Combination skin demands tailored formulations that neither overwhelm nor under-hydrate. With regular application, a good moisturizer maintains skin elasticity.
Facial oils are becoming a must-have for their ability to deeply nourish. In contrast to traditional hydrators, beauty oils deliver nutrients more effectively to provide skin barrier support. Ingredients such as rosehip oil, packed with essential fatty acids, improve skin elasticity. If you have acne-prone skin, fast-absorbing oils such as squalane moisturize without clogging pores. Skin prone to dehydration need deeply hydrating oils such as avocado, which restore moisture.
